Portable laser welding machineThe working principle is based on the high energy density and precise control of lasers. The laser beam focuses on the surface of the workpiece, instantly generating high temperature, causing the material to quickly melt and form a weld seam. Compared with traditional methods such as arc welding and gas welding, laser welding has higher thermal efficiency and smaller heat affected zone. This means that the deformation and thermal stress of the material during the welding process are greatly reduced, thereby improving the welding quality and the performance of the workpiece.

Portable laser welding machines have a wide range of applications, covering multiple industries such as automotive manufacturing, aerospace, shipbuilding, and metal processing. In the field of automobile manufacturing, it can be used for tasks such as body welding and component repair; In the aerospace field, portable laser welding machines can meet the welding needs of various complex structures; In shipbuilding, it can be used for welding and repairing ship structural components; In the metal processing industry, portable laser welding machines have become an ideal choice for various processes such as cutting, drilling, and carving.
In addition to industrial applications, portable laser welding machines have shown great potential in fields such as healthcare, jewelry, and electronics. For example, in dental treatment, portable laser welding machines can be used for tooth restoration and the production of orthodontic appliances; In jewelry processing, it can be used for welding and decoration of fine jewelry; In electronic product manufacturing, portable laser welding machines can achieve precise connection and packaging of micro components.

Of course, although portable laser welding machines have many advantages, they also face some challenges. Firstly, there is the issue of cost. Due to the requirements of high-end laser technology and precision manufacturing, the price of portable laser welding machines is relatively high. This to some extent limits its popularity. Next are safety and environmental issues. Although laser welding itself has high safety and environmental friendliness, it is still necessary to pay attention to protective measures and waste disposal in practical applications.
